Allswell 10-inch Hybrid vs GhostBed Signature Hybrid: What Actually Differs

Both the Allswell 10-inch Hybrid and GhostBed Signature Hybrid are hybrid mattresses, so the real differences come down to firmness tuning, performance ratings, and price rather than construction type. The GhostBed Signature Hybrid stands 12" tall versus 10" for the Allswell 10-inch Hybrid — a 2.0" gap that matters if you need deep-pocket sheets or are pairing with an adjustable base. The Allswell 10-inch Hybrid is the firmer of the two at 7/10 (medium-firm), and the GhostBed Signature Hybrid sits at 5.5/10 (medium) — a meaningful enough gap that sleeper position and weight should drive the choice. The single largest performance gap is in cooling: the GhostBed Signature Hybrid rates noticeably higher than the Allswell 10-inch Hybrid, which is the deciding factor if that dimension is high on your list. On a Queen, the Allswell 10-inch Hybrid runs $282 versus $1,399 for the GhostBed Signature Hybrid — roughly $1,117 (80%) less, which is enough to factor into the decision unless the pricier model wins clearly on the specs you care about.

Which Is Better For Your Sleep Style?

Side sleepers
GhostBed Signature Hybrid

Higher pressure-relief rating, which is what protects hip and shoulder contact points in the side position.

Back sleepers
GhostBed Signature Hybrid

Medium includes the option closest to a balanced medium feel for back sleepers (vs Medium-Firm).

Stomach sleepers
Allswell 10-inch Hybrid

Medium-Firm includes the firmer published option (vs Medium), which may better suit shoppers who prefer more surface support.

Hot sleepers
GhostBed Signature Hybrid

Stronger cooling rating, which matters most for sleepers who run hot or live in warm climates.

Heavier sleepers (230+ lb)
GhostBed Signature Hybrid

better long-term durability and stronger perimeter / edge support — the two specs heavier sleepers should weigh most.

Lighter sleepers (under 150 lb)
GhostBed Signature Hybrid

Medium includes the softer published option (vs Medium-Firm), which can make contouring easier for lighter sleepers.

Couples / light sleepers
Either works

Motion isolation rated the same on both — neither has a transfer-disturbance edge.
